Chick hatched "Outside" the shell!!!!!
Those veins actually run through the layer you can see in my photo that is growing to surround the yolk. They dont actually run through the membrane. The membrane plus a layer of these trophoblast cell is a lot like a placenta with 2 layers-an outer layer and inner layer. The inner layer is where the vessels are.
Todays pics-ring is getting bigger and more blood and the layer of cells (white) has nearly surrounded the yolk. I cant keep the top wet enough...the cells normally migrate around the entire sphere. Not just the sides.
